Key Differences

Home Prices

Gainesville's median home price of $298,688 is lower than Tampa's $373,641.61 by 20%.

Monthly Rent

Renting in Gainesville costs $1,687.7/mo compared to $2,008.84/mo in Tampa—a difference of $321.14/mo.

Buy vs Rent Verdict

Both cities currently favor renting.
